腾讯的二面过了很久了,可很遗憾仍是没有过...ios
但仍是把面经写出来吧!一是再过几天我真的什么都忘了,要常总结,攒人品;二是也许能够为后来者提供点帮助面试
本来觉得二面通常会问一些项目上的知识,前一个晚上还熬夜整理了以前的项目,结果直接致使隔天面试时特么困,脑子很很差使,竟然简单的算法题都作不出来算法
算法题:不用额外的变量来实现strlen。若是只是单纯的实现strlen应该也是不难的,但不用到变量,那么能够使用递归的方法来解:spa
#include <iostream> using namespace std; int Strlen(const char *p) { if(p==NULL)return -1; else if(*p=='\0') return 0; else return Strlen(++p)+1; } int main() { cout<<Strlen("123456"); system("pause"); return 0; }